Introduction

When working with plasterboard, having the right tools is crucial for achieving professional results. Cutters plasterboard are specifically designed to make clean and accurate cuts in drywall, which is essential for fitting and installing panels seamlessly. These tools come in various forms, including utility knives and specialized drywall saws, each tailored for different cutting tasks.

Using a cutters plasterboard not only enhances your efficiency but also ensures that the edges are smooth and ready for finishing. Here are some key benefits of using these specialized tools:
  • Precision: Cutters plasterboard allow for precise cuts, which are vital for fitting boards together without gaps.
  • Ease of Use: Most cutters are designed to be user-friendly, making them accessible for both professionals and DIY enthusiasts.
  • Durability: High-quality cutters are built to withstand the rigors of cutting through tough plasterboard materials.
  • Safety: Many plasterboard cutters come with safety features that help prevent accidents during use.
When selecting a cutter, consider factors such as the type of cuts you need to make, the thickness of the plasterboard, and your comfort level with handling tools.
